Opposites attract in this magical, delightful contemporary romance from the #1 New York Times bestselling author of Say You'll Remember Me. After a wild bet, gourmet grilled-cheese sandwich, and cuddle with a baby goat, Alexis Montgomery has had her world turned upside down. The cause: Daniel Grant, a ridiculously hot carpenter whoโs ten years younger than her and as casual as they comeโthe complete opposite of sophisticated city-girl Alexis. And yet their chemistry is undeniable. While her ultra-wealthy parents want her to carry on the family legacy of world-renowned surgeons, Alexis doesnโt need glory or fame. Sheโs fine with being a โmereโ ER doctor. And every minute she spends with Daniel and the tight-knit town where he lives, sheโs discovering just whatโs really important. Yet letting their relationship become anything more than a short-term fling would mean turning her back on her family and giving up the opportunity to help thousands of people. Bringing Daniel into her world is impossible, and yet she canโt just give up the joy sheโs found with him either. With so many differences between them, how can Alexis possibly choose between her world and his? Review: I never wanted this to end! - Alexis is driving back to Minneapolis when she ends up in a ditch in the small town of Wakan trying to avoid hitting a raccoon. Just great! The tow truck company she called will be awhile but in the meantime one of the locals stops to help her out of her predicament. She decides to stop at the local bar for a quick bite to eat before she heads off home again. Daniel Grant was the guy who stopped to help her, he and his ancestors are a part of the fabric of this small town. He runs his family B&B and is a very talented carpenter. He is also the town Mayor, which is not as arduous as it sounds with a population of 350 people for most of the year. Alexis being in the local bar raises lots of interest for all the single guys. Theyโve either grown up with, know of or have dated every woman in town so Alexis is fair game as far as they are concerned. Daniel swoops in and saves her from them all with his witty banter and general warmth. Alexis has recently gone through a break up. After lots of therapy she has come out much stronger and more aware of what she wants/deserves in a future partner. One thing she does now is that she is not interested in dating or relationships. This is how she ends up spending the night in Danielโs bed. Let me put some context around thisโฆ โDaniel somehow managed to be charming and completely down-to-earth while also exuding pure sex. It was the most baffling combination. And one I wasnโt capable of refusing.โ Daniel truly is a genuinely lovely guy and Alexis probably canโt explain it herself but there is a connection there. A pull towards each other that even after a few hours of conversation over a grilled cheese sandwich they find themselves naked together. Alexis knows she will never return and she really needs a night like this. Daniel does not disappoint, he is attentive, intuitive and gives her a night she will never forget. After Alexis leaves, Daniel is left wondering if it was all just a beautiful dream. This gorgeous, intelligent and articulate woman - who he thinks is waaay out of his league has left her mark on him. He cannot stop thinking of her and he will do anything to spend more time with her. And then she calls him.. Alexisโ path in life was carved out for her before she was born. Her family has generations of surgeons that have come before her but she defied the norm a little by becoming an ER doctor. Not a career deemed as anything of significance to her father. She constantly fails to meet the high expectations set by him and her recent break up with a surgeon he considered a son to him has not helped. Now she is the sole Montgomery doctor left at the hospital and he expects her to step up. As you can see, Alexisโ world and Danielโs are so far removed from each other but despite all of this she finds herself driving to see him most weekends. They are developing feelings for each other, big, huge, deep feelings that can never be any more than that. His life is in Wakan, and hers in Minneapolis - both anchored by the generations that came before them. โThis relationship would never expand. It would never take a deep breath and pull in those around us. It wouldnโt fill its lungs with my people and my life. It would just be this. Only this.โ Honestly, my heart was breaking for this couple. Alexis has one true best friend, Bri (you are going to love her) and other than that no one else is in her cheer team, apart from Daniel. He makes her feel seen, he believes in her, he cares so much for her and put simply, all he wants is Alexis. She is so torn up over what she feels for Daniel, she is being pulled in so many directions and is drowning in the weight of expectations thrown upon her. โNothing could convince me this woman wasnโt made for me to love. I think my soul recognized hers the second I laid eyes on her. Our bodies knew it the very first night. The power she had over me terrified me. But it also gave me clarity.โ Okay, so with all of this heavy angst there are also equal amounts of fun, laughter and swoon :) There is Chloe the goat, Kevin Bacon the pig, Hunter the dog and all the wonderful townsfolk of Wakan. The banter between Alexis and Daniel was so adorable and I laughed so much. I really hope we get more stories from the wonderful secondary characters in this story. Well this was my reading highlight of the month, all those wonderful book feels that I love were here in abundance, I never wanted this to end! โI love youโ he whispered. โWe are together. This isnโt over. I am in absolute disbelief over how great this book is! Part of Your World is one of those rare reading experiences where you realize within the first few pages that youโre in the hands of a truly gifted storyteller. Abby Jimenezโs writing is, without exaggeration, one of the most marvelous, effortless, and beautifully flowing styles I have ever read. There are absolutely no fillers โ not one wasted sentence โ from page one all the way to the end. Every scene serves a purpose, every emotion hits exactly where itโs supposed to, and every line feels alive. I read this book in a single day because I simply could not put it down! The chemistry between Alexis and Daniel is magnetic, tender, and deeply immersive. Their worlds contrast so strongly โ her structured, high-pressure, city life versus his warm, grounded, small-town charm โ and yet their connection feels inevitable. The way Jimenez builds their relationship is nothing short of masterful: slow-burn tension, heart-melting moments, laugh-out-loud humor, and emotional depth that catches you off guard in the best way. The themes of family expectations, healing, self-worth, choosing your own happiness, and breaking free from toxic cycles are woven in with such skill that you feel every moment right along with the characters. Danielโs kindness and emotional maturity? Absolutely irresistible. Alexisโs journey toward reclaiming her identity and joy? Empowering and beautifully done. And the side characters โ from the adorable dog to the charming townspeople โ make the world feel rich, comforting, and incredibly real. This book gave me warmth, romance, drama, humor, and hope, all perfectly balanced. Itโs one of those stories that stays with you, one you want to hug when you finish because it made you feel so much. Abby Jimenez simply did not miss. She wrote an emotionally intelligent romance that felt both modern and timeless, and Part of Your World was just a magical work.
